Humans had discovered the bubbly benefits of yeast many, many years ago and today use it in order to churn up a variety of foods such as bread, cakes, pizza bases, cookies, muffins, and many more. All these products turbo pure use fermentation methods that include the presence of oxygen. This ends in aerobic respiration where yeast ferments the key ingredient, i. e. dough, directly into mild ethanol and co2 that gives bubbles of gas within that dough. The ethanol is burnt away during the baking process and what you get is actually light and fluffy loaf of bread, cakes, and so on.
Over the years, man also found that when yeast was allowed to ferment a combination of water with some other ingredients including a variety of fruits such as grapes, apples, and so on, greens such as potatoes, etc, or even grains like wheat, maize, and so forth, then the resultant beverage contained moderate to powerful alcohol strength that provided a wonderful buzz on consumption. The result was the introduction of several liquid yeast items such as draught beer, wine, whiskey, rum, vodka, and others that you can find lined up in stores all over the globe. However, to be able to turn the actual liquid mixture directly into liquid alcoholic beverages, alcoholic beverages producers need to make use of the anaerobic respiration process in which oxygen is actually barred from the fermentation process. The result is actually purer and also more powerful ethanol along with carbon dioxide gas.
The commonest kinds of yeast which is utilized to ferment the majority of products is Saccharomyces cerevisiae and lots of variants are used in order to ferment different types of food and liquids. For instance, baker�s yeast is used to ferment various bakery foods whilst wine yeast is employed to ferment different wine beverages. Nevertheless, regular yeast is quite delicate when it comes to tolerating strong alcohol and also high temperatures. Thus, normal yeast can die whenever alcohol strength levels peak at 12 percent of if the temperature rises significantly during the ethanol fermentation process.
